Meaning of chumocracy | Babel Free

Noun CEFR B2

Definitions

A form of oligarchy: government characterised by nepotism and the frequent appointment to public office of friends or those of similar social background to those in power.

UK, countable, uncountable

Examples

How thrilling it would have been[…] if [Sadiq] Khan had denounced the [Thames garden] bridge in every way: […] as a symbol of the chummerythe chumocracy, eventhat so offends the democratic and egalitarian traditions he is proud to represent.”
The sums are so vast, the secrecy so shocking, thatchumocracy” doesn’t begin to capture what Britain has becomeredolent as we are of banana republics, the Russian oligarchy and failed states.”
“Mr Hancock secretly appointed her [Gina Coladangelo] to his department as an unpaid adviser on a six-month contract in March last year. It sparked claims of a “chumocracywhen it became public knowledge in November.”
